Abstract:

Problem Statement. This paper examines a pressing issue: orchestrating semantic analysis methods to support data storage and na­vigation in the process of supporting scientific research. To address this issue, semantic analysis methods and the conditions for their applicability to various types of data are examined.

Objective. To develop a semantic data infrastructure for intelligent processing of scientific information.

Results. A multi-level ontology is proposed as a basis for representing scientific knowledge, along with a semantic scientific graph for knowledge navigation.

Practical Relevance. The obtained results demonstrate the applicability of the proposed ontological approach for the integration and semantic analysis of scientific data, coupled with the use of large language models during knowledge graph navigation.
